TPS92200: Deviation of max Duty

Part Number: TPS92200


Tool/software:

Dear TI engineers,

I would like to know how much voltage can be output when Vin is 10.8V in the worst case consideing deviation.
In the section 6.6 of dataseet, I can see that Max duty cycle is defined as 99%. But 99% is only typical value and there is no description on Min value.
I think it can be calculated by using the maximum value of tMIN_OFF and the minimum value of tMAX_ON if both value have independent deviation(in the case if both value have proportional relation, the worst ratio of  both value can be used).

    I understand TPS92200 can automatically expand the switching frequency by expanding the on tme in the case if VOUT becomes very close to VIN.
    But 99% on duty is calculated by using tMAX_ON(typ 6.6us) and tMIN_OFF(typ 65ns), right? 6.6us/(6.6us+65ns) x 100 = 99[%]
    If this is correct, the minimum value of  Max duty cycle is calculated by using the maximum value of tMIN_OFF and the minimum value of tMAX_ON if both value have independent deviation(in the case if both value have proportional relation, the worst ratio of  both value can be used).

    I have checked with our design team. The have provided the min value of max duty, 98.5%. It is calculated by max on and min off like you mentioned.
